1. The History of FC Barcelona:
Barcelona Football Club was founded on November 29, 1899, by Hans Gamper. Throughout its history, the club has experienced both triumphs and challenges. Barcelona has won a total of 23 La Liga titles and 27 Spanish Cups, making it one of the most successful clubs in Spanish football history. Additionally, the team has won 5 UEFA Champions League titles, among other international honors. Barcelona's philosophy of attractive, possession-based football, known as "tiki-taka," has also made a significant impact on the footballing world.
2. Installations and Services:
FC Barcelona boasts world-class facilities at their homeground, Camp Nou stadium. With a seating capacity of over 99,000 spectators, it is the largest stadium in Europe and has witnessed countless historic moments in football. The club also has excellent training facilities, including state-of-the-art training grounds and equipment to support the development of players at all levels.

4. Honors:
Barcelona has an impressive list of honors, both domestically and internationally. Alongside their numerous domestic titles, Barcelona has achieved significant success in European competitions. The club's five UEFA Champions League titles, including their historic treble-winning season in 2008-2009, are a testament to their status as a European powerhouse. Barcelona has also won the FIFA Club World Cup multiple times, highlighting their global success.
